We’ll go into further detail on each method below, but here’s a high-level introduction to how they work: Open card sort: Participants sort cards into groups that make sense to them, and label each group themselves. Closed card sort: Participants sort cards into groups you give them. Hybrid card sort: Participants sort cards into groups you ... Updated over a week ago. The Results Matrix shows you the number of times each card was sorted into your pre-set categories in a closed card sort. The darker the blue, the more often the card was sorted into that category. You won't see the Results Matrix if you've run an open card sort because you don't give participants any pre-set categories.Are you looking to give your living spaces a fresh, inviting look? Gather fast, actionable insights for informed design decisions. 🚀 | About us: Our user research tools allow you to test, benchmark and make ...The PCA shows you the three most popular participant IAs (completed card sorts) based on how often 2 cards are paired together in the same category throughout the whole study. This information can be a useful starting place when you're starting to draft a few potential website structures. It's called a 'Participant-centric analysis' because ...Go to Optimal Workshop. There are two main approaches for recording observations: note-taking and behavioural coding. Note-taking is the simplest and the one I recommend, especially if you’re new to user research. As you watch the user, write down each observation on a sticky note. You should have a separate sticky note for each ... Qualitative research – Focused on exploration. For Part 1, we’re going to look at how to interpret and analyze the results from open and hybrid card sorts. In open card sorts, participants sort cards into categories that make sense to them and they give each category a name of their own making.
